NSCDC arrests three suspects for defiling minor in Kwara

The suspects were apprehended on Sunday, 01/09/2024, following a report lodged by the victim’s father at the NSCDC Offa Division.

The Kwara State Command of the Nigeria Security and Civil Defence Corps (NSCDC) has taken three individuals into custody for allegedly sexually assaulting a 12-year-old girl in Offa, Kwara State.

According to the command’s spokesperson, Ayoola Michael Shola, the suspects – Adeleke Oke (81), Sikiru Lawal (37), and Moshood Suleiman Ayinde (37) – were arrested on September 1, 2024, after the victim’s father reported the incident to the NSCDC Offa Division.

The case has been transferred to the Gender Unit for further investigation, which has revealed that the suspects had “unlawful carnal knowledge of the minor on different occasions and threatened her not to open up to anyone about the illicit acts”.

A medical examination confirmed that the victim’s hymen was ruptured, providing “clear evidence of repeated sexual penetration”.

The suspects have confessed to the crime and will be charged to court for onward prosecution.

The State Commandant, Dr. Umar Mohammed, has denounced the “despicable act”, urging the public to partner with the command in its efforts to combat defilement, rape, and other sexual offenses.
